Blockchain

Since a good decentralized program, bitcoin operates as opposed to http://bitkingzslots.com/pt a central expert otherwise solitary administrator, [ 76 ] to ensure you can now manage a new bitcoin address and you will transact without the need for any acceptance. [ six ] : ch. one This is accomplished due to a professional marketed ledger named an effective blockchain one to records bitcoin transactions. [ 77 ] The new blockchain is adopted as the a purchased variety of prevents. For each cut-off contains good SHA-256 hash of your early in the day take off, [ 77 ] chaining all of them inside chronological order. [ six ] : ch. seven [ 77 ] The fresh blockchain was maintained because of the an equal-to-peer system. [ 29 ] : 215�219 Personal reduces, public contact, and you may transactions in this blocks are public information, and will end up being tested using an effective blockchain explorer. [ 78 ] Nodes validate and you may shown deals, for each and every maintaining a duplicate of the blockchain to have ownership verification. [ 79 ] Another cut off is made all ten full minutes typically, upgrading the new blockchain round the all nodes instead of central supervision. Unlike a classic ledger one tracks real currency, bitcoins occur digitally while the unspent outputs off transactions. [ six ] : ch. 5

Contact and transactions

Basic chain regarding possession. Used, a transaction have one or more input and more than that yields. [ 80 ] Regarding the blockchain, bitcoins try associated with particular strings called tackles. Most often, a speech encodes a great hash of just one public trick. Carrying out for example a message concerns promoting an arbitrary personal trick and you may upcoming computing the fresh relevant target. This step is virtually instantaneous, although contrary (picking out the individual key to possess a given address) is almost impossible. [ six ] : ch. four Posting such an effective bitcoin address will not risk the private secret, and is also not likely in order to happen to build good made use of trick with money. To use bitcoins, citizens need its private the answer to electronically sign deals, being confirmed of the circle with the personal trick, remaining the non-public secret wonders. [ six ] : ch. 5 A message get encode the latest hash out of a bitcoin script one to specifies more complex standards to pay the funds. A common example try „multisig”, in which multiple type of individual secrets need certainly to collectively sign one exchange one to tries to spend the finance. [ 6 ] : ch. eight Bitcoin purchases fool around with an ahead-such as scripting words, [ 6 ] : ch. 5 associated with a minumum of one enters and you can outputs. When sending bitcoins, a user determine the brand new recipients’ tackles and also the number for each efficiency. This enables giving bitcoins to numerous readers in one single purchase. To end twice-spending, for every single enter in have to make reference to an earlier unspent efficiency on the blockchain. [ 80 ] Playing with numerous inputs is similar to playing with multiple gold coins within the good dollars exchange. Such as a finances purchase, the sum of inputs is also exceed the brand new intended amount of payments. In this case, an extra efficiency normally return the alteration back once again to the latest payer. [ 80 ] Unallocated enter in satoshis regarding the deal become the purchase fee. [ 80 ] Shedding a private key setting shedding usage of the latest bitcoins, with no almost every other proof of possession recognized by process. [ 29 ] For example, in the 2013, a user destroyed ?seven,five-hundred, respected at United states$seven.5 mil, because of the eventually discarding a painful push to the personal secret. [ 81 ] It’s estimated that to 20% of the many bitcoins are shed. [ 82 ] The non-public trick also needs to end up being kept magic as its publicity, like thanks to a document breach, may cause theft of your own related bitcoins. [ six ] : ch. 10 [ 83 ] Since [update] , everything ?980,000 is stolen away from cryptocurrency exchanges. [ 84 ]